CARICOM
(Caribbean Agribusiness)
CARICOM recently launched a portal for agribusiness information exchange that offers useful and current information to assist in the development of the Caribbean agribusiness sector, a one-stop website for stakeholders to contribute content and share ideas that promote the development of the agribusiness sector.

SIDALC
(Alliance of Agricultural Information and Documentation Services of the Americas)
SIDALC, which is led by TEEAL partner, IICA, has endeavored to expand access to information since almost as long as TEEAL. This international alliance shares access to the agricultural literature in Latin American library catalogs via one online portal.
